Поделиться через


Метод ValidationRule.Delete (Visio)

Удаляет объект ValidationRule из документа.

Синтаксис

expression. Удалить

Выражение Переменная, представляющая объект ValidationRule .

Возвращаемое значение

Nothing

Замечания

Вызов метода Delete также удаляет все объекты ValidationIssue , связанные с правилом проверки.

Пример

Следующий пример кода основан на коде, предоставленном : Дэвид Паркер

В следующем примере Visual Basic для приложений (VBA) показано, как с помощью метода Delete удалить правило проверки с именем "Unglued Connector" из набора правил проверки с именем "Анализ дерева ошибок" в активном документе.

' Delete a named rule from a named rule set.
Public Sub Delete_Example()

    Dim strValidationRuleSetNameU As String
    Dim strValidationRuleNameU As String

    Dim vsoValidationRuleSet As Visio.ValidationRuleSet

    strValidationRuleSetNameU = "Fault Tree Analysis"
    strValidationRuleNameU = "UngluedConnector"
    Set vsoValidationRuleSet = ActiveDocument.Validation.RuleSets(strValidationRuleSetNameU)
    
    ' Delete the rule.
    vsoValidationRuleSet.Rules(strRuleNameU).Delete
    
End Sub

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.